Key Features of Effective Adding and Subtracting Decimals Worksheets
1. Clear Instructions
Effective worksheets begin with explicit directions, ensuring students understand what is required. Clear instructions reduce confusion and help students focus on solving problems accurately.
2. Progressive Difficulty
Good worksheets are organized to gradually increase in difficulty. Starting with simple problems that involve aligning decimal points and basic addition or subtraction, the exercises advance to more complex problems involving multiple steps, larger numbers, or decimal place value challenges.
3. Varied Problem Types
Including different types of problems keeps learners engaged. For example:
- Adding decimals with the same number of decimal places
- Adding decimals with different numbers of decimal places
- Subtracting decimals with borrowing or regrouping
- Word problems involving decimal addition and subtraction
4. Visual Aids and Tools
Visual aids such as number lines, decimal grids, or place value charts can help students understand the concept of decimal positioning and value, especially for visual learners.

Sample Problems for Adding and Subtracting Decimals Worksheet
Adding Decimals
- 0.75 + 1.25 = ____
- 3.4 + 2.56 = ____
- 0.005 + 0.095 = ____
- 12.3 + 4.56 = ____
Subtracting Decimals
- 5.6 - 2.3 = ____
- 7.89 - 4.56 = ____
- 10.005 - 0.995 = ____
- 15.2 - 7.75 = ____
Word Problems
- Sarah bought a notebook for $2.75 and a pen for $1.50. How much did she spend in total?
- A car traveled 150.5 miles in the morning and 120.75 miles in the afternoon. What was the total distance traveled?
- John has $20.00. He spends $4.75 on lunch and $3.50 on a book. How much money does he have left?

Frequently Asked Questions
What is the best way to approach adding decimals on a worksheet?
Align the decimal points vertically and add each column as you would with whole numbers, ensuring the decimal places are aligned correctly for accurate results.
How do I subtract decimals effectively on a worksheet?
Line up the decimal points vertically, add zeros if necessary to make the decimals have the same number of decimal places, then subtract as usual, making sure to keep the decimal points aligned.
What strategies can help students improve their accuracy with decimal addition and subtraction?
Practicing aligning decimal points, using visual models like number lines, and checking answers by estimating can help students improve their accuracy.
Are there common mistakes to watch out for when solving decimal problems on a worksheet?
Yes, common mistakes include misaligning decimal points, forgetting to add zeros to make decimals equal in length, and confusing the placement of decimal points during calculations.
